Fabulous Flowers!


Its a lovely sunny day here in Surrey and I have been thinking of Spring and have been inspired to get  out some flower stamps.  I have made this card for two challengers "The Fabulous Flowers " challenge at Hero Arts and "A Bit of Sparkle" challenge at A Blog Named Hero. 

To make the background I cut a rectangle of card with my Avery Elle Die "Pierced Rectangles" then i covered it in Spiced Marmalade distress ink before stamping with Hero Arts "Floral Background" inked with Versamark ink and sprayed with perfect pearls.  I then added the flowers I had made from the Colour Layering Hibiscus Hero Arts Set.  Lastly I added some sequins and the sentiment.
